Pure Stock Races 68 Ram Rod vs. 65 GTO

had a blast at the Pure Stock Drag Race this past weekend
up in Stanton MI.

Got to "shoe" Dave H's Ram Rod for the event and we got matched
up against a 65 389 Tri Power GTO for best 2 out of 3 match race.

Ram Rod 3 - GTO "ZERO"

The match race was win 2 out of 3 but they had all matches run three races regardless of whether or not 1 car won first 2 races.

There were more Olds there this year than I recall ever seeing
in the past representing our marque with some very fine looking and
running machines.

Yup that year was the first time that car raced in over 20 years. Still had everything original in it at that time .. turned out to be a blessing cause after that event - ( it cracked the bell housing too ) we tore the motor down to see how it faired only to find I think it was 3 pistons with missing skirt pieces and broken rings. That was a bomb waiting to go off.

Actually Chris - I managed to ring out a 14.06 on Sat AM. Not sure what combo is in it now is matched as should be - If we can get Dave's 66 L69 dialed in - will probably run that one next year and have a reason then to dive back into the 68 to see if we can get it back in the mid -low 13's where it belongs.
